It should be able to.  The Optima battery that I will be using is a starting
type of battery, not a deep cycle, with a CCA (cold cranking amps) of 1100 A
(model D31T).  It is one that is specifically recommended by commercial
installers of my make/model of thruster.  Optima "spiral-wound" AGM
(absorbed glass matt) batteries are pretty amazing batteries.  They hold
their charge for months on end without having to be float charged.   (But
they are easily destroyed by over-charging or over-voltage.)

In practice, operation of a thruster is usually bursts of power lasting
10-30 seconds.    Periods of minutes are very unusual.but can occur.
